There are plenty of weird things as well. Why can't humans synthesise vitamin C? My cat can; in fact, most animals can. But not humans and most other primates: we lost this ability. This is probably because at the time we didn't really need it as we got enough from dietary sources, but dropping it just because you don't need it right now is of course a bit silly and short-sighted, but nature doesn't have any foresight of course. This is the sort of thing why species go extinct.
Another well known "design flaw" is the blind spot in our eyes, which is there for no real reason in particular other than what we might call "legacy reasons" in programming terms.
